Sheridan silver, often referenced in the context of silver-plated items or flatware, typically contains a base metal coated with a thin layer of silver rather than being solid silver. The term can also refer to specific brands or manufacturers known for their silver-plated goods. It’s important to check for markings or certifications to determine the authenticity and composition of specific items. If you're considering purchasing or valuing Sheridan silver, consulting with an expert or appraiser is advisable.
